D. Discussing new concepts and practicing new skills #1


The use of organic fertilizer and other locally made pesticides is
important in the community sustainable Organic matter is the most
important source of plant nutrients contributing to the fertility of the
soilby adding nutrients to it. There are different ways of preparing
organic fertilizer.
1.Mulching-Upon decomposition, it promotes granulation or clinging
together of the soil
2. Composting- a decayed mixture of plants that is used to improve
the soil in a garden.
3.Cover crop- are creeping and bushy plants with dense vegetative
growth, grown mainly to cover and protect soil. Provides larges
quantities of nitrogen.
4. Liquid fertilizer- Plants and trees are able to take in the nutrients
almost immediately.keep is excellent for all plants, providing them
with many nutrients and protecting them from stress.
5.Vermicomposting-composting plants with worms wherein the
process faster producing a rich nutritious soil made by the
earthworms.

H. Making Generalizations and Abstractions about the lesson


Ways of preparing compost
Ask: What are the steps in preparing organic fertilizers and
compost?
The following are the steps in preparing organic fertilizer or
compost
1.Dig a compost pit usually at the back of the yard.
2. Build a shelter to protect the pile from the rain measuring at least
2 meters by 3 or 4 meters. An alternative to building a shelter is to
cover the pile with plastic materials.
3. Gather and prepare all compost materials
4. Pile a layer of grass and kitchen leftover about 12-15 cm thick
to cover the area.
5. Level the area. Then pile the second layer of animal manure
about 5-8cm. thicken layer over the first layer.
6. Make other layers similar to the first two layers until the pile
reaches 11/2 meters.
7. Sprinkle the pile with water to make it moist.
8. Cover the top pile with banana leaves.
9. Provide breathers like bamboo holes in the middle of the pile.
10. The compost will be ready after three months.

D. Discussing new concepts and practicing new skills #1
What are the benefits of using organic fertilizer and made pesticides?
Benefits of Using Organic Fertilizer and made pesticides
1. It is environment Friendly. It does not harm the soil, unlike in
organic fertilizer which can be toxic if applied in excess to the soil.
2. It fertilizers the soil and improve structureand fertility.
3. Insect pest life cycle will be stopped.
4. Prevents the spread of plant diseases
5. The growth of plant will continue to progress
6. Higher yield is expected.
7. It is inexpensive.
8. It is safe to use.
